DESIGN AND PRACTICE FOR THE AERONAUTICAL PRACTICAL PROJECT IN THE MECHANICS “101 PLAN”

  • According to the overall requirements of the Mechanics “101 Plan”, this article discusses the design and practice for the core practices - aeronautical practical projects. Focusing on our university's “Chief Engineer Cultivation Culture” and starting from the cultivation of the characteristics of a “chief engineer” with “specialized expertise, strong systematic perspective, emphasis on practice, and capable of taking responsibility”, the objectives for aeronautical practical projects are established according to the current development status and trends in the aeronautical field. 10 practical projects covering aerodynamics, solid mechanics, and aeroelastics have been designed at three levels of basic projects, advanced projects and cutting-edge projects. Taking aircraft vibration theory teaching practice as an example, we introduce the specific implementation of aeronautical practical projects in our school's mechanics course teaching.
